MySQL是一種常用的關系型數據庫管理系統。當需要從日期中獲取年份時,MySQL提供了多種函數來解決這個問題。以下將介紹兩種常用的獲取年份的MySQL函數。
YEAR(date)
此函數用于從日期中提取年份。其中date為日期值,可以是日期列名、日期值或者日期表達式。例如:
SELECT YEAR('2022-01-01'); SELECT YEAR(date_column) FROM table_name;
以上兩個語句都會輸出2022。
EXTRACT(YEAR FROM date)
此函數也可以從日期中提取年份。其中date為日期值,可以是日期列名、日期值或者日期表達式。例如:
SELECT EXTRACT(YEAR FROM '2022-01-01'); SELECT EXTRACT(YEAR FROM date_column) FROM table_name;
以上兩個語句也都會輸出2022。
雖然這兩種函數都可以用于從日期中提取年份,但是它們的使用方法和效率有所不同。在實際應用中應該根據具體情況選擇合適的函數。
上一篇mysql可變長數據類型
下一篇mysql從庫建新表